Goa, March 7 -- Residents of Khanyale village have launched a hunger strike in protest against ongoing stone quarrying activities near the Tilari reservoir, which they claim pose a significant threat to the safety of the dam. The quarrying operations, with seven to eight mines active in the area, have led to excessive soil accumulation in the reservoir, endangering the structural integrity of the dam.

The villagers are deeply concerned that if the dam were to break, Khanyale village would be devastated, with catastrophic consequences. The villagers are calling on both the Maharashtra and Goa governments to take immediate action to halt the quarrying activities and address the environmental risks posed by the mines.
